-- | /See:/ 'newCreateCustomDataIdentifier' smart constructor.
data CreateCustomDataIdentifier = CreateCustomDataIdentifier'
{ -- | A unique, case-sensitive token that you provide to ensure the
-- idempotency of the request.
clientToken :: Prelude.Maybe Prelude.Text,
-- | A custom description of the custom data identifier. The description can
-- contain as many as 512 characters.
--
-- We strongly recommend that you avoid including any sensitive data in the
-- description of a custom data identifier. Other users of your account
-- might be able to see this description, depending on the actions that
-- they\'re allowed to perform in Amazon Macie.
description :: Prelude.Maybe Prelude.Text,
-- | An array that lists specific character sequences (/ignore words/) to
-- exclude from the results. If the text matched by the regular expression
-- contains any string in this array, Amazon Macie ignores it. The array
-- can contain as many as 10 ignore words. Each ignore word can contain
-- 4-90 UTF-8 characters. Ignore words are case sensitive.
ignoreWords :: Prelude.Maybe [Prelude.Text],
-- | An array that lists specific character sequences (/keywords/), one of
-- which must precede and be within proximity (maximumMatchDistance) of the
-- regular expression to match. The array can contain as many as 50
-- keywords. Each keyword can contain 3-90 UTF-8 characters. Keywords
-- aren\'t case sensitive.
keywords :: Prelude.Maybe [Prelude.Text],
-- | The maximum number of characters that can exist between the end of at
-- least one complete character sequence specified by the keywords array
-- and the end of the text that matches the regex pattern. If a complete
-- keyword precedes all the text that matches the pattern and the keyword
-- is within the specified distance, Amazon Macie includes the result. The
-- distance can be 1-300 characters. The default value is 50.
maximumMatchDistance :: Prelude.Maybe Prelude.Int,
-- | The severity to assign to findings that the custom data identifier
-- produces, based on the number of occurrences of text that matches the
-- custom data identifier\'s detection criteria. You can specify as many as
-- three SeverityLevel objects in this array, one for each severity: LOW,
-- MEDIUM, or HIGH. If you specify more than one, the occurrences
-- thresholds must be in ascending order by severity, moving from LOW to
-- HIGH. For example, 1 for LOW, 50 for MEDIUM, and 100 for HIGH. If an S3
-- object contains fewer occurrences than the lowest specified threshold,
-- Amazon Macie doesn\'t create a finding.
--
-- If you don\'t specify any values for this array, Macie creates findings
-- for S3 objects that contain at least one occurrence of text that matches
-- the detection criteria, and Macie assigns the MEDIUM severity to those
-- findings.
severityLevels :: Prelude.Maybe [SeverityLevel],
-- | A map of key-value pairs that specifies the tags to associate with the
-- custom data identifier.
--
-- A custom data identifier can have a maximum of 50 tags. Each tag
-- consists of a tag key and an associated tag value. The maximum length of
-- a tag key is 128 characters. The maximum length of a tag value is 256
-- characters.
tags :: Prelude.Maybe (Prelude.HashMap Prelude.Text Prelude.Text),
-- | The regular expression (/regex/) that defines the pattern to match. The
-- expression can contain as many as 512 characters.
regex :: Prelude.Text,
-- | A custom name for the custom data identifier. The name can contain as
-- many as 128 characters.
--
-- We strongly recommend that you avoid including any sensitive data in the
-- name of a custom data identifier. Other users of your account might be
-- able to see this name, depending on the actions that they\'re allowed to
-- perform in Amazon Macie.
name :: Prelude.Text
}
deriving (Prelude.Eq, Prelude.Read, Prelude.Show, Prelude.Generic)
